Popularity of Business, Management & Marketing at Florida Tech
During the 2020-2021 academic year, Florida Institute of Technology handed out 64 bachelor's degrees in business, management & marketing. This is a decrease of 15% over the previous year when 75 degrees were handed out.
In 2021, 385 students received their master’s degree in business, management & marketing from Florida Tech. This makes it the #133 most popular school for business, management & marketing master’s degree candidates in the country.
In addition, 2 students received their doctoral degrees in business, management & marketing in 2021, making the school the #208 most popular school in the United States for this category of students.

Florida Tech Business, Management & Marketing Bachelor’s Program
During the 2020-2021 academic year, 64 students graduated with a bachelor's degree in business, management & marketing from Florida Tech. About 72% were men and 28% were women.

Florida Tech Business, Management & Marketing Master’s Program
Of the 385 students who earned a master's degree in Business, Management & Marketing from Florida Tech in 2020-2021, 57% were men and 43% were women.
The majority of master's degree recipients in this major at Florida Tech are white.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 50% of students fell into this category.
